Constructed of a linen blended composite fabric finished on the exterior with a weatherproof lacquer in a classic oilcloth style, dyed in a four colour Lozenge camouflage pattern consisting of light brown, dark brown, dark green, and rust brown geometric shapes, with a central eyelet reinforced with a blackened and boiled leather grommet, securely held in place with two rows of hand stitching, with a paper label embroidered to the
